How Our Water Damage Repair Service Actually Works

With Water Damage Repair, a proper process matters. Cutting corners can lead to further damage, increased costs, and even safety risks. Our team follows a proven step-by-step approach to ensure the job is done right the first time. From initial assessment to final cleanup, we’ll guide you through every stage of the process.

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our technicians will arrive quickly to assess the damage and develop a customized plan to address your specific needs. We’ll identify the source of the issue and create a detailed scope of work. Our goal is to reduce downtime and get you back to normal as quickly as possible.

Step 2: Water Extraction and Drying

Using specialized equipment, we’ll extract all standing water and begin the drying process. We’ll use high-velocity air movers and dehumidifiers to speed up the process.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and ensuring a safe environment for you and your family.

Step 3: Cleaning and Sanitizing

Once the area is dry, we’ll thoroughly clean and sanitize all affected surfaces. We’ll use eco-friendly cleaning products and equipment to remove any remaining moisture and contaminants. This step helps prevent mold growth and ensures a healthy living space.

Step 4: Restoration and Repairs

Our team will work with you to restore your property to its original condition. We’ll repair or replace any damaged materials, including drywall, flooring, and cabinets. Our goal is to make your home look and feel like new again.

Water Damage Repair v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ak (less than 1 gallon per minute) Yes No You can likely fix it yourself with a DIY repair kit.
Large leak (over 1 gallon per minute) No Yes This needs spec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age.
Standing water (over 2 inches deep) No Yes This needs professional equipment to extract and dry the area safely and efficiently.
Mold or mildew growth No Yes This needs specialized equipment and expertise to safely remove and prevent further growth.
Structural damage (e.g., warped flooring or buckled walls) No Yes This needs professional expertise to assess and repair the damage safely and efficiently.
Uncertainty about the cause or extent of the damage No Yes This needs professional expertise to assess and find out the best course of action.

Water Damage Repair Cost in Tyrone, GA

The cost of Water Damage Repair can vary dep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on national averages and may vary depending on your specific situation. Our team will provide a free estimate to ensure you have a clear understanding of the costs involved.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ction and Dr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, type of flooring, and equipment needed
Cleaning and Sanitizing $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, type of surfaces, and equipment needed
Restoration and Repairs $1,000 – $5,000 Extent of damage, type of materials, and labor required
Structural Repairs $500 – $2,000 Extent of damage, type of materials, and labor required
Mold Remediation $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of surfaces, and equipment needed

How do I prevent water damage in the future?

Preventing water damage needs regular maintenance and inspections. Check your pipes and appliances regularly for signs of wear or damage. Consider installing a water shut-off valve and sump pump to protect your home from future damage.
